Ingredients
  • 8 ounce Mixed greens
  • 1 cup Butternut squash
  • 1 cup Pomegranate seeds
  • 4 ounce Goat cheese
  • 0.5 cup Pecans
  • 1 medium Apple
  • 1 small Red onion
  • 4 tablespoon Balsamic vinaigrette
Instructions
  1. Preheat the oven to 400°F (200°C).
  2. Peel and dice the butternut squash.
  3. Toss the diced butternut squash with olive oil, salt, and pepper.
  4. Spread the butternut squash on a baking sheet and roast for 20 minutes, or until tender.
  5. In a large bowl, combine the mixed greens, roasted butternut squash, pomegranate seeds, crumbled goat cheese, chopped pecans, sliced apple, and thinly sliced red onion.
  6. Drizzle the balsamic vinaigrette over the salad and toss to combine.
  7. Serve immediately and enjoy!
